Was Kamal’s ‘Moving out of Tamil Nadu’ threat genuine?




Now that ‘Ulaganayagan’ Kamal Haasan’s Vishwaroopam has finally hit the screens in Tamil Nadu and has been declared a super hit, some shocking revelations are coming through. Speaking strictly on condition of anonymity, sources close to Kamal say that the threat meted out by the star was a ‘calculated one’ and which was going to become a reality in future.
The ‘Moving out of Tamil Nadu’ threat was meant mainly to ‘prepare’ the fans and the people to be ready for the eventuality wherein Kamal would have to be away from the state/country for at least the next 2-3 years as he is all set to commence his first-ever Hollywood venture shortly. By meting out the threat, Kamal was only conveying (albeit indirectly) that he would invariably be out of the country for a long time, it is pointed out.
The Hollywood venture is likely to make Kamal stay in U.S. for a longer period as unlike the practice in Kollywood or Bollywood, Hollywood films take too long time to complete. The pre-production work, shooting schedule, the post-production work, publicity and the process of promoting the film, etc. are expected to keep Kamal busy at least for the next two years from now.
Kamal has ‘brilliantly’ prepared the ground (for a longer stay abroad) during the pre-release crisis which resulted in the delayed release of Vishwaroopam in Tamil Nadu. It is also said that in order to make his stay in U.S. a peaceful one, he went over the board in depicting U.S. as a peace-loving country in the script of Vishwaroopam and this explains the ‘theme’ of an Indian spy going out of the way to save U.S.
